Domanda

Voglio abbinare link come <a href="mailto:my@email.com">foo</a>, ma questo non funziona funziona solo in Nokogiri:

doc/'a[href ^="mailto:"]'

Qual è il modo giusto di fare che? Come faccio a farlo con Hpricot?

È stato utile?

Soluzione 2

Questo funziona su Hpricot:

doc/'a[@href ^="mailto:"]'

Impossibile trovare un modo per fare la ricerca xpath però. A quanto pare, Hpricot non supporta starts-with: http://wiki.github.com / hpricot / hpricot / supportati-XPath-espressioni

Altri suggerimenti

doc/"//a[starts-with(@href,'mailto')]"
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top